Tambourines with no drum head, from Groove Masters Percussion, EMUS and NINO, in six, eight and ten inch.
Take the head off a tambourine and what is left is the frame and the jingles. The sound is brighter, sharper and shorter, with nothing to soften the attack, and it cuts through a room full of drums and voices better than a headed tambourine does.
For a classroom set, that plus the weight is usually the deciding factor. A headless tambourine is lighter to hold for a whole session, there is no skin for a student to press a thumb through, and it plays perfectly well tapped against a palm, a knee or a hip.
Jingle count and row layout set the character. The EMUS eight inch has five jingles and the ten inch has seven, both single row, which gives a clean and defined sound. The GMP double row models in two sizes are louder and denser, with a longer shimmer after each hit.
NINO's eight inch headless model comes in a choice of colours, and EMUS wooden headless tambourines are stocked in two sizes.
